The progression of quantum software development methodologies has emerged as pivotal as quantum computer technology transitions from theoretical research to functional applications. Unlike classic coding, quantum software development necessitates inherently distinct frameworks to formula design and implementation, exploiting quantum effects to attain computational benefits. Engineers must account for quantum-specific concepts such as quantum gates, circuit depth, and decoherence when crafting strategies for quantum chips. The quantum software development network encompasses groundbreaking simulators that permit scientists to evaluate and optimize their methods prior to click here deploying them on real quantum hardware.

The underpinning of quantum computing relies upon cutting-edge quantum hardware systems that mark an exceptional transition from conventional computer designs. These systems function on laws that leverage the enigmatic traits of quantum physics, including superposition and coherence, to process data in manners that classic computers like the ASUS ProArt merely cannot duplicate. Modern quantum chips necessitate extreme ambient settings, typically running at heat levels nearing absolute nothingness to preserve the fine quantum states essential for computing. The technical hurdles involved in developing stable quantum hardware systems are immense, demanding meticulous manufacturing methods and cutting-edge materials field. Enterprises worldwide are investing billions into building increasingly robust and scalable quantum processors, with each generation delivering better coherence times and diminished mistake ratios.

The real-world quantum entanglement applications encompass many domains and continue to grow as our understanding deepens. Quantum entanglement, frequently called 'spooky action at range,' enables correlations between particles that stay connected despite the physical distance dividing them. This phenomenon creates the core of quantum cryptography systems that ensure unassailable security for sensitive communications. In quantum detection applications, linked quanta can reach appraisal precision that surpasses traditional limitations, advancing advancements in domains like gravitational wave discovery and magnetism observation. Quantum entanglement applications likewise play a pivotal position in quantum teleportation protocols, which permit the transfer of quantum intelligence over distances without tangibly relocating the elements themselves. Scholarly organizations are exploring the manner in which entanglement can enhance quantum radar systems and heighten the accuracy of atomic clocks employed in global navigation systems. Programming languages purposefully designed for quantum computer have become vital instruments for harnessing the full potential of quantum systems efficiently. These quantum programming languages furnish abstractions that allow programmers to convey quantum algorithms in ways that can be expertly executed and carried out on quantum hardware. The syntax and architecture of quantum coding languages should facilitate the probabilistic nature of quantum computation and the requirement to manage quantum states throughout program execution.
